NCIS Season 21 Can Easily Achieve The Ideal ‘Gibbs’ Comeback

blank

Fans of NCIS season 21 are looking forward to the return of Mark Harmon’s legendary character, Leroy Jethro Gibbs.

With Harmon’s departure from the series, many fans had longed for him to return, even if only in a cameo. And it appears that the perfect chance has presented itself.

Gibbs left the team in NCIS season 19, retiring to Alaska after facing intense challenges.

Despite this, the possibility of his return lingered, especially with the show’s landmark 20th season on the horizon. Now, with season 21 underway, the chance for Gibbs’ comeback is more promising than ever.

One possible scenario for Harmon’s comeback is a touching tribute to the popular character of Dr. Donald “Ducky” Mallard, played by original cast member David McCallum, who has unfortunately passed away.

In a forthcoming episode commemorating Ducky’s farewell, the team will solve one final case in his honor. Given Gibbs’ long-standing connection with Ducky, which dates back before the series began, it’s only fair that he attend the burial.

What makes this potential cameo so compelling is its simplicity. There’s no need for grand gestures or elaborate storylines. Gibbs can quietly pay his respects to his dear friend without stealing the spotlight from the occasion.

This approach not only honors the legacy of the characters but also respects the emotional gravity of the moment.

While some may yearn for a more extensive return for Gibbs, a quick appearance seems acceptable given the circumstances. Ignoring Ducky’s burial would be a disrespect to one of the show’s most treasured friendships. Furthermore, Harmon can participate in the episode without facing the logistical hurdles of a prolonged stay on site.

In a season filled with anticipation, the return of Mark Harmon’s Leroy Jethro Gibbs promises to be a poignant and heartfelt moment for NCIS fans everywhere.
